In Loving Memory of Alicia Anne Farrah
Alicia Anne Farrah, age 35, of Delton, passed away on January 16, 2025. Alicia was born on November 2, 1989, in Kalamazoo, the daughter of James Farrah and Kelli Farrah-Schoonard. Alicia's wild spirit shone through at a young age as she began working at Sajo's when she was just 14. Throughout her life, she continued to work in customer service, where she befriended everyone and showed them the person they needed when they were growing up. However, Alicia's purest joy was found outside of work while spending time with family and lifelong friends.
Alicia always put others above herself no matter what she was facing in life. She gave people the confidence they didn't know they had or needed. She always had a smile on her face that lit up the entire room. Although Alicia was upfront and told people exactly how it was, she was also the one that never let you leave until you gave her a hug.
Alicia is survived by her siblings, Terry (Tarra) Farrah, Misti (Justin) Wortinger, Sara, and Sydny, as well as many others who loved her, including several adoring nieces and nephews. Alicia now joins her grandparents, Jim Farrah I, Terry Burns, Anne Schoonard, her Uncle Scott Farrah, Brother Jim A. Farrah II, and her best friend, Joshua Horton, who preceded her in death.
Alicia will be remembered as "Licia" by all or as "Al" to her dear friends from high school. She will be cherished as a kind, funny, and beautiful soul who had a heart of gold. She was the one who always called you "kiddo" and made you feel like her sibling.
Alicia's family will receive friends on Friday, January 24, 2025, from 5:00 PM to 8:00 PM at the Williams-Gores Funeral Home. Those who wish to make memorial contributions are asked to consider the needs of the family.
